Comprehensive Guide to Liability Waiver
Understanding the Participant's Release and Waiver of Liability
The Participant's Release and Waiver of Liability is a crucial document designed to protect both participants and the Prestonwood Polo & Country Club. This waiver serves as a legal agreement in which individuals expressly waive their right to sue for any injuries or damages sustained during horseback riding activities.
This document is governed by the legal framework established by the State of Texas, emphasizing its significance in ensuring clarity and safety for all parties involved. The waiver outlines the risks associated with horseback riding, making it essential for all participants to fully understand its implications.

Who is eligible to sign this waiver?
The waiver must be signed by the participant, and if the participant is a minor, it must also be signed by a parent or legal guardian. This ensures that all parties understand the liability involved.
Is there a deadline for submitting the waiver?
Typically, the waiver should be completed and submitted before engaging in any horseback riding activities at the club. Check with Prestonwood Polo & Country Club for specific requirements as they may vary.
How do I submit the completed waiver?
You can submit the completed waiver electronically via pdfFiller or print it out and present it in person at the Prestonwood Polo & Country Club. Ensure all required signatures are in place before submission.
What supporting documents are needed?
Generally, no supporting documents are required with this waiver. However, having identification or proof of legal guardianship may be helpful if the participant is a minor.
